Language: English Publisher: Simon & Schuster Ltd What is in Owen Grays head ... and who is trying to kill him for it Twenty-nine-year-old Owen Gray always believed the miraculous device in his brain had been implanted for purely medical reasons. as a way of controlling the debilitating seizures he suffered in his youth. But when the Supreme Court rules that amplified humans like Owen are not protected by the same basic laws as pure humans. his world instantly fractures. As society begins to unravel and a new class war is ignited by fear. Owens father. a doctor who originally implanted the amp. confides something that will send him on a harrowing journey-his amp has hidden potential to do so much more than he imagined ... and he is now in grave danger.
